Базовые понятия HTML и CSS для начинающих

Базовые понятия HTML и CSS для начинающих

Построение веб-ресурсов начинается с освоения двух ключевых технологий. HTML отвечает за построение и наполнение страниц. CSS управляет визуальным дизайном элементов.

Специалисты применяют HTML для расположения текста, изображений, ссылок и других компонентов. CSS позволяет определять оттенки, гарнитуры, размеры и позиционирование контейнеров. Эти языки функционируют вместе и дополняются друг друга.

Изучение казино вулкан открывает путь к профессии веб-разработчика. Понимание базовых правил позволяет разрабатывать работающие и привлекательные порталы. Новички разработчики могут быстро приобрести прикладные умения и внедрить их в живых работах.

Что такое HTML и зачем он требуется сайту

HTML расшифровывается как HyperText Markup Language. Язык разметки устанавливает структуру веб-документов и упорядочивает содержимое веб-страниц. Браузеры интерпретируют HTML-код и представляют информацию в понятном для пользователей формате.

Каждый элемент веб-страницы определяется особыми командами. Титулы, абзацы, списки, таблицы и формы генерируются с помощью меток. Метки являются собой инструкции, помещённые в угловые скобки. Браузер обрабатывает эти команды и строит визуальное представление контента.

Без HTML невозможно построить Вулкан казино любого рода. Язык разметки выступает основой для всех сайтов. Поисковые системы исследуют HTML-структуру для каталогизации веб-страниц. Корректная структура улучшает места веб-ресурса в выдаче поиска.

HTML постоянно развивается и приобретает новые опции. Новейшая версия HTML5 поддерживает видео, аудио и динамические компоненты. Разработчики могут интегрировать мультимедийный контент без дополнительных расширений. Смысловые элементы способствуют Вулкан лучше понимать роль разных элементов страницы.

Главные метки и структура веб-страницы

Любой HTML-документ содержит определённую иерархическую структуру. Корневой компонент html вмещает всё наполнение веб-страницы. Внутри размещаются два ключевых блока: head и body.

Блок head содержит служебную информацию о документе. Здесь прописывается название страницы, подключаются стили и скрипты. Пользователи не видят содержимое этого раздела напрямую. Раздел body вмещает весь отображаемый содержимое.

Для организации контента применяются различные теги:

  • h1-h6 формируют титулы разнообразных рангов
  • p создаёт текстовые параграфы
  • a формирует гиперссылки на иные страницы
  • img добавляет иллюстрации в документ
  • ul и ol создают маркерные и нумерованные списки
  • table упорядочивает информацию в табличном формате

Семантические метки создают разметку более понятной. Компонент header определяет шапку портала. Тег nav объединяет навигационные линки. Блок main вмещает основное наполнение веб-страницы. Footer располагается в подвальной области и содержит контактную информацию.

Корректная структура файла значима для доступности. Программы чтения с экрана задействуют казино Вулкан для навигации по странице. Логическая организация компонентов облегчает восприятие информации всеми группами пользователей. Правильный скрипт функционирует правильно во всех новых обозревателях.

Как CSS отвечает за внешний облик сайта

C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ей задают визуальное представление HTML-элементов. Технология разделяет стилизацию от структуры файла.

Без стилей все сайты выглядят одинаково. Браузер выводит текст чёрным цветом на белом фоновом цвете. Названия получают обычные габариты. CSS помогает модифицировать любой аспект внешнего вида.

Стили можно подключить тремя способами. Отдельный документ соединяется с HTML-документом через тег link. Внутренние стили располагаются в теге style. Инлайновые стили прописываются в свойстве тега.

Каскадность подразумевает очерёдность использования правил. Inline стили получают высший вес. Внутренние стили замещают отдельные. Браузер использует максимально точное директиву к каждому элементу.

CSS контролирует всеми графическими характеристиками. Программисты устанавливают тона заднего плана и текста. Стили изменяют размеры, поля и рамки блоков. Актуальный Вулкан казино задействует анимации и переходы для формирования интерактивных визуальных эффектов.

Селекторы, атрибуты и значения в CSS

Инструкция CSS формируется из трёх частей. Селектор обозначает компонент для оформления. Свойство задаёт параметр оформления. Значение задаёт конкретный значение.

Селекторы отбирают элементы по разнообразным признакам. Селектор тега назначает стили ко всем компонентам конкретного вида. Селектор класса работает с атрибутом class. Селектор идентификатора выбирает индивидуальный тег по свойству id.

Комбинированные селекторы создают более точные правила. Селектор потомка определяет вставленные элементы. Селектор дочернего тега действует только с прямыми наследниками. Псевдоклассы применяют стили при определённых ситуациях.

Свойства задают различные элементы оформления. Свойства color и background-color управляют цветовой палитрой. Свойства width и height задают габариты. Атрибуты margin и padding управляют интервалы.

Значения записываются в различных видах. Оттенки задаются в шестнадцатеричном формате, RGB или именами. Габариты измеряются в пикселях, процентах или относительных мерах. Грамотное использование селекторов помогает Вулкан результативно контролировать стилизацией совокупности элементов.

Управление с оттенками, гарнитурами и отступами

Цветовое оформление формирует графическую атмосферу веб-страницы. Атрибут color меняет цвет содержимого. Свойство background-color определяет фон блока. Цвета записываются несколькими методами: именами, шестнадцатеричными кодами или параметрами RGB.

Шестнадцатеричный тип начинается с символа диеза. Запись формируется из шести элементов, определяющих красный, зелёный и синий компоненты. Вид RGB применяет числовые значения от 0 до 255 для каждого канала. Тип RGBA включает свойство альфа-канала.

Типографика сказывается на удобочитаемость материала. Параметр font-family определяет гарнитуру шрифта. Параметр font-size задаёт габарит символов. Параметр font-weight управляет толщину начертания. Параметр line-height устанавливает межстрочный интервал.

Стандартные гарнитуры присутствуют на всех платформах. Внешние гарнитуры скачиваются с внешних серверов. Сервис Google Fonts даёт бесплатную библиотеку гарнитур. Специалисты задают несколько шрифтов в порядке приоритета.

Интервалы формируют пространство вокруг компонентов. Атрибут margin генерирует наружные интервалы между элементами. Параметр padding создаёт внутренние интервалы от рамок до контента. Интервалы можно устанавливать для каждой грани отдельно или единым параметром единовременно для всех краёв. Грамотное задействование казино Вулкан усиливает графическую организацию и понимание информации.

Блочная концепция и размещение компонентов

Блочная модель определяет структуру каждого HTML-элемента. Схема складывается из четырёх областей: наполнения, внутреннего поля, обводки и внешнего интервала. Понимание этой принципа требуется для корректного регулирования размерами.

Секция содержимого включает текст и иллюстрации. Внутренний отступ padding формирует пространство между содержимым и рамкой. Обводка border очерчивает компонент отображаемой линией. Внешний интервал margin создаёт промежуток до прилегающих блоков.

Атрибут box-sizing модифицирует подсчёт габаритов. Параметр content-box включает только контент. Вариант border-box включает padding и border в суммарную ширину.

Параметр display определяет режим представления. Блочные блоки занимают всю доступную ширину. Inline элементы находятся в одной ряду. Значение inline-block объединяет характеристики обоих режимов.

Свойство position регулирует размещением. Значение relative смещает компонент относительно первоначального положения. Absolute размещает блок относительно родительского блока. Актуальный Вулкан казино применяет Flexbox и Grid для формирования многоуровневых компоновок.

Гибкая верстка для различных аппаратов

Гибкая разработка гарантирует верное визуализацию веб-ресурса на всех мониторах. Посетители заходят на страницы с ПК, планшетов и мобильных устройств. Дизайн обязан адаптироваться под габарит дисплея самостоятельно.

Медиазапросы применяют стили в зависимости от свойств устройства. Правило @media контролирует ширину монитора и прочие свойства. Программисты генерируют индивидуальные наборы стилей для разных диапазонов величин.

Метод mobile-first начинает создание с версии для телефонов. Начальные стили описывают стилизацию для небольших дисплеев. Медиазапросы добавляют расширения для больших мониторов.

Адаптивные структуры применяют пропорциональные меры расчёта. Ширина элементов определяется в процентах вместо постоянных пикселей. Flexbox и Grid генерируют гибкие структуры без сложных вычислений.

Изображения требуют специального подхода при оптимизации. Атрибут max-width со значением 100% блокирует выступание картинок за края блока. Параметр srcset скачивает изображения разного качества. Грамотная внедрение казино Вулкан усиливает пользовательский впечатление на всех типах аппаратов.

Частые недочёты новичков при разработке с HTML и CSS

Новички специалисты совершают распространённые ошибки при разработке страниц. Знание типичных ошибок позволяет исключить их в личных работах. Коррекция недочётов на ранних фазах экономит время и улучшает качество программы.

Основные недочёты при разработке с разметкой и стилями:

  • Незакрытые теги ломают структуру файла и вызывают к неправильному визуализации
  • Использование старых тегов вместо современных семантических тегов
  • Недостаток альтернативного текста для иллюстраций ухудшает доступность материала
  • Встроенные стили в HTML осложняют поддержку и модификацию дизайна
  • Некорректная вложенность компонентов порождает проблемы в организации
  • Чрезмерное использование идентификаторов вместо классов затрудняет повторное задействование стилей

Проблемы с CSS также встречаются часто. Стартующие упускают указывать величины расчёта для числовых параметров. Излишне точные селекторы усложняют переопределение стилей. Отсутствие сброса стилей обозревателя создаёт различия в представлении на различных системах.

Игнорирование кроссбраузерной согласованности вызывает к проблемам. Веб-страница может идеально смотреться в одном браузере и некорректно в другом. Верификация кода посредством особые сервисы обнаруживает синтаксические промахи. Систематическая верификация помогает Вулкан сохранять отличное уровень создания и соответствие требованиям.

Leave a Reply

Your email address will not be published. Required fields are marked *